What is Mesothelioma?

Mesothelioma is a rare form of cancer that develops in the thin layer of tissue that lines many of our internal organs. The signs of mesothelioma generally do not appear until the disease has reached an advanced stage. The first signs are usually shortness of breath and chest pain. It can also be accompanied by a dry cough.

The primary cause of mesothelioma is asbestos exposure. People who work in certain industries have greater risk of exposure, including those who work on shipyards, construction sites, factories, power plants and mines. Other occupations at risk include plumbers (asbestos was used in pipe insulation), electricians, roofers and contractors for drywall.

A diagnosis of mesothelioma could be tragic, but fortunately there are options for treatment available. Treatment options include chemotherapy, surgery or radiation therapy. The kind of treatment that is most effective is dependent on the type of mesothelioma as well as the patient's overall health. Certain treatments may also aid in easing some of the uncomfortable symptoms, including nausea, fatigue and 1-888-636-4454 pain.

The majority of mesothelioma cases involve mesothelioma pleural, which develops in the lung's lining. However, it could also develop in the peritoneum (the abdomen's lining) or the testicle. There is a less dangerous mesothelioma that is called benign mesothelium. It does not cause death or pose a threat.

Asbestos Exposure

Asbestos is absorbed by the lungs, usually over a long period of time. Asbestos was employed in a variety of industries, including manufacturing, construction ships, power generation, and shipbuilding. Workers could be exposed in a direct or indirect way by the substances they brought home on their clothing. The risk of mesothelioma is highest for those who have many exposures for a prolonged period of time.

Symptoms of mesothelioma often do not appear for a long time after the initial exposure. It is crucial to speak with an expert if you are concerned.

Mesothelioma Treatment

The type of treatment that a patient receives for mesothelioma is contingent upon the stage of their cancer and location and other factors. The doctors treating mesothelioma typically include treatments like chemotherapy, surgery radiation therapy, 1-888-636-4454 immunotherapy.

The pleura is a tissue that covers the lungs and chest cavity. Other rare types of mesothelioma are found in the peritoneum (the membrane that linings the abdominal cavity) and around the testicles or the heart.

Since mesothelioma may cause symptoms similar to those caused by other lung conditions and conditions, it can be difficult for a doctor to diagnose. To determine if you have mesothelioma, your doctor will do an examination of your body and inquire about your medical background. Your doctor can also request imaging tests, such as a CT scan or Xray, or a biopsy to confirm the diagnosis. A biopsy is when a small piece of mesothelioma-affected tissue is removed for examination under a microscope. This procedure is performed using VATS (Video assisted thoracoscopic surgery) it is a kind of keyhole surgery.

If the cancer is discovered in its earliest stages, doctors can remove the affected lung or pleura during surgery. This is called active or curative treatment for mesothelioma. The mesothelioma that is in its later stages can be more difficult to treat.

In addition to the surgery and other marquette mesothelioma legal treatment options, doctors may recommend palliative treatment to control symptoms like shortness of breath or pain. They could also insert a tube into your chest to remove fluids from the pleura, or put you on a pump that drains your stomach.

If mesothelioma is spreading to other organs of the body, additional treatment options include immunotherapy or targeted therapy. This is different from traditional chemotherapy, which makes use of drugs to kill cancerous cells and decrease their number. These treatments are based on the notion that mesothelioma tumors have certain mutations that can be targeted with new medications.
